Найдено 120 результатов

alexzv
2010.08.02, 19:19
Форум: Общие вопросы (Yii 1.x)
Тема: CGridView и AR relations
Ответы: 5
Просмотры: 3630

Re: CGridView и AR relations

Насчет имени категории это понятно ;-) А вот за остальное спасибо, теперь все понятно. Насколько я понял, то в 'value' можно функцию вызывать, передавая ей значение $data и в качестве значения поля будет выводиться результат работы функции... Я так понимаю что 'value' обрабатывается с помощью eval()...
alexzv
2010.08.02, 18:42
Форум: Общие вопросы (Yii 1.x)
Тема: CGridView и AR relations
Ответы: 5
Просмотры: 3630

Re: CGridView и AR relations

Разобрался, основная проблема была в dataProvider, а именно строка $criteria->with = array('Category'); - название relations у меня с маленькой буквы, т.е. $criteria->with = array('category'); Так же в relations необходимо указывать имя поля 'category_id', т.е. то же, что и имя реального поля в БД (...
alexzv
2010.08.02, 18:08
Форум: Общие вопросы (Yii 1.x)
Тема: CGridView и AR relations
Ответы: 5
Просмотры: 3630

CGridView и AR relations

Не могу разобраться, что я делаю не так. Есть 2 таблицы `Good` и `Category`, так же соответствующие имена моделей. В `Good` я добавил foreign key: ALTER TABLE `Good` ADD CONSTRAINT `Good_fk_category` FOREIGN KEY (`category_id`) REFERENCES `Category` (`id`); В моделе Good описываю relations: public f...
alexzv
2010.07.07, 01:26
Форум: Общие вопросы по программированию
Тема: DOMDocument и кодировка
Ответы: 1
Просмотры: 2280

Re: DOMDocument и кодировка

Дело в том что для XML в PHP "родной" является именно кодировка UTF-8. При выводе имени атрибута он соответственно выводит его в UTF-8, а при сохранении уже преобразовывает документ в windows-1251. Как вариант решения - имя атрибута перекодировать в windows-1251 при помощи iconv или самост...
alexzv
2010.07.07, 01:11
Форум: Общие вопросы по программированию
Тема: Zend search lucene
Ответы: 5
Просмотры: 3362

Re: Zend search lucene

Спасибо, почитаю :-)
alexzv
2010.07.06, 00:02
Форум: Общие вопросы по программированию
Тема: Zend search lucene
Ответы: 5
Просмотры: 3362

Re: Zend search lucene

Кстати, а какие еще есть альтернативы? А то везде используют или Zend search lucene или Sphinx...
alexzv
2010.07.05, 23:57
Форум: Общие вопросы по программированию
Тема: str_ireplace и кириллица
Ответы: 3
Просмотры: 3710

Re: str_ireplace и кириллица

Чтобы str_ireplace работал с кириллицей необходимо настроить локаль или если это сделать не удается (как показывает практика почему-то не на всех хостингах локаль возможно настроить) использовать какие-то ухищрения - например вначале переводить текст к нижнему регистру отдельно написанной функцией и...
alexzv
2010.07.03, 15:23
Форум: Обо всем
Тема: Выбор хостинга
Ответы: 11
Просмотры: 6006

Re: Выбор хостинга

А на Воле (dc.volia.com) никто хоститься не пробовал? На прошлой работе мы у них физические сервера арендовали (так как с виртуальными прикола не понимаю, стоят столько же...), правда то ли "Профи", то ли "Бизнес" сервера... Так вот качество очень не плохое, если какие-то проблем...
alexzv
2010.06.29, 22:54
Форум: Общие вопросы (Yii 1.x)
Тема: Code Generator (Gii) и charset windows-1251
Ответы: 5
Просмотры: 2571

Re: Code Generator (Gii) и charset windows-1251

Да, и по моему, не "windows1251", а "windows-1251" ;-)
alexzv
2010.06.29, 15:14
Форум: Обо всем
Тема: symfony 2 with doctrine 2
Ответы: 2
Просмотры: 4031

Re: symfony 2 with doctrine 2

Yii в сравнении с Symfony мне кажется более интересным, так как имеет свой Active Record, в отличии от Symfony, который опирается во всем на Doctrine или Propel. Хотя если смотреть на Yii-ский реляционный Yii для выборки данных из нескольких таблиц, то в этом случае возможно лучше смотреть в сторону...
alexzv
2010.06.15, 01:03
Форум: Общие вопросы по программированию
Тема: Хранение ссылки на изображение
Ответы: 7
Просмотры: 4282

Re: Хранение ссылки на изображение

А у меня все еще более запутанно ;-) В базе храню ссылку на исходное изображение (оно может быть как локальное - тогда только имя, так и с другого сервера), а отображаю на сайте уже через специальную функцию, которая выводит его в нужном размере и кеширует измененный вариант. Например так: 1. Есть и...
alexzv
2010.06.15, 00:54
Форум: Общие вопросы по программированию
Тема: Кто в чем ведет разработку?
Ответы: 83
Просмотры: 28489

Re: Кто в чем ведет разработку?

Вылеты скорее от операционной системы зависят... У меня под Ubuntu часто Firefox и OpenOffice например вылетают... думаю на что-то более стабильное переходить, на тот же Debian например... В Windows тоже от версии к версии могут глюки появляться...
alexzv
2010.06.11, 09:30
Форум: Общие вопросы по программированию
Тема: Кто в чем ведет разработку?
Ответы: 83
Просмотры: 28489

Re: Кто в чем ведет разработку?

Во первых работаю исключительно под Linux и обычно пишу на своем небольшом ноуте, а это сразу накладывает ограничение как на прожорливость программы, так как на удобство использования (с разрешением 1024x768). Так что основными моими инструментами являются jEdit и иногда Gedit (так как только послед...
alexzv
2010.06.11, 09:08
Форум: Общие вопросы (Yii 1.x)
Тема: Layouts в пользовательской части и модуле
Ответы: 8
Просмотры: 2462

Re: Layouts в пользовательской части и модуле

Вы бы хоть исходный код предоставили...
alexzv
2010.06.03, 09:28
Форум: Документация и рецепты (Yii 1.x)
Тема: Качество документации.
Ответы: 60
Просмотры: 36905

Re: Качество документации.

По поводу качества документации - я тоже недавно начал изучать фреймворк, до этого писал на чистом PHP... Действительно трудно вникнуть во все нюансы и к примеру чтобы разобраться в работе с БД, нужно перечитать десяток статей, чтобы в голове все уложилось. Не плохо было бы нормально описать саму ра...
alexzv
2010.05.31, 14:24
Форум: Общие вопросы (Yii 1.x)
Тема: Проблем при Update зашифрованного пароля!
Ответы: 25
Просмотры: 6690

Re: Проблем при Update зашифрованного пароля!

if(!empty($this->password)  && (strlen($this->password)<32)||$this->isNewRecord){ ....}  в принципе не плохой вариант, если пользователь не использует пароль больше 32-х символов... :D Но все равно душа не успокаеваеться, хотелось бы при редактировании давать чистое поле пароля, я когда то ...
alexzv
2010.05.31, 00:24
Форум: Общие вопросы (Yii 1.x)
Тема: Проблем при Update зашифрованного пароля!
Ответы: 25
Просмотры: 6690

Re: Проблем при Update зашифрованного пароля!

По моему ничего сложного тут нет, у себя делал подобным образом (предположим таблица называется User): 1. Добавляем в view echo CHtml::hiddenField('User[oldpassword]',$model->password);  2. Дальше в контроллер (в actionUpdate) $model->attributes=$_POST['User']; $model->oldpassword = $_POST['User']['...
alexzv
2010.05.24, 05:47
Форум: Авторский код и библиотеки
Тема: CImageHandler - работа с изображениями
Ответы: 103
Просмотры: 81287

Re: CImageHandler - работа с изображениями

Отлично, что теперь работает с изображениями по URL. Можно ли добавить еще несколько функций, которые бы расширили функциональность? Это Adaptive Resizing - вписывание картинки в определенные размеры, фактически resize по меньшей стороне и потом центрированная обрезка. Есть в стандартном PHP Thumb, ...
alexzv
2010.05.15, 08:08
Форум: Авторский код и библиотеки
Тема: CImageHandler - работа с изображениями
Ответы: 103
Просмотры: 81287

Re: CImageHandler - работа с изображениями

Не очень удобно, что нельзя загрузить картинку по URL. По этому остановился на EasyPhpThumb. Только вот не проверял пока, как он дружит с прозрачными PNG...
alexzv
2010.05.09, 07:15
Форум: Общие вопросы (Yii 1.x)
Тема: Вопрос про модель поверх модели :-)
Ответы: 1
Просмотры: 1365

Вопрос про модель поверх модели :-)

Вот пишу сайт для агенства недвижимости и назрел вопрос... Все сейчас нормально работает, но хотел бы получить комментарии по коду, возможно что-то можно сделать более правильно?.. С Yii я работаю не давно и пока всех тонкостей не знаю :) Есть объект недвижимости (его описывает таблица в базе данных...